The UAE has reaffirmed its continued support for the Palestinian people with a new medical aid shipment delivered to Gaza as part of 'Operation Chivalrous Knight 3'.
The 12-tonne shipment was coordinated by Gulf Pharmaceutical Industries, Julphar, in partnership with the Saqr bin Mohammed Al Qasimi Charity and Humanitarian Foundation.
Hospitals in Gaza are facing a severe healthcare collapse, with critical shortages of medicines.
The latest shipment includes antibiotics, pain relievers, allergy medications and treatments for burns and infections—urgently needed supplies to support overstretched hospitals.
This effort reflects the UAE’s long-standing commitment to humanitarian aid and follows recent contributions to the World Health Organisation to bolster emergency medical response in crisis zones.
